Modern Methods

Therapy Techniques We Use

We focus on helping individuals regain strength, mobility, and confidence after injury or prolonged pain using evidence-based tools.

IASTM

Using specialized tools to gently address muscle tightness and improve tissue movement.

Soft Tissue Care

Cup Therapy

Gentle suction to help improve blood flow and ease localized muscle tension.

Muscle Relief

Dry Needling

A precise technique used to release deep muscle "knots" and restore normal function.

Trigger Point Work

Laser Therapy

Laser therapy used to support pain relief and support natural tissue recovery.
